One of the larger discussion points of this episode is likely going lớn be the series’ treatment of Gohan. Much lượt thích the episode’s title warns its audience, this installment begins khổng lồ turn Gohan into a punching bag for the Frieza Force. Dragon Ball Super can’t be an easy viewing experience for those that are Gohan fans. Dragon Ball Z seemed to take great interest in weaving the tale that Goku’s offspring might very well kết thúc up being the most powerful being in the universe. The series’ final arc even saw Gohan elevating himself to “Mystic Gohan” and achieving a new tier of power nguồn that would have him operating at a degree of strength which has never been seen before. That’s not who Gohan is now. In the interim time between Dragon Ball Z and Dragon Ball Super, Gohan threw away his martial arts gi for a graduation cap và gown. Accordingly, Gohan is now exceedingly out of practice và at the bottom of the fighting barrel as a result. As a result, it might be pure torture for some people when Gohan isn’t able khổng lồ decimate Frieza’s entire army singlehandedly, or that someone lượt thích Tagoma is so easily capable of defeating him.

During all of this Frieza quickly clues in to the fact that quantity does not always overrule quality, so he turns to his vị trí cao nhất men lớn rectify the situation. On that note, this episode also offers up more of the growing power nguồn struggle within the ranks of Frieza’s army. Sorbet, the leader of the army, turns khổng lồ Shisami for help, but then something genuinely surprising happens. Before Shisami gets the chance to lớn make much of an impression, the bitter Tagoma executes not only him, but nearly pulls off a doubleheader with Gohan in the process. Just like that, Tagoma is able lớn get Frieza’s attention và he’s told that once they finish wiping out the planet, he’ll have a cushy position at the head of the Frieza Force (not khổng lồ mention his very own planet). We’re also shown that Tagoma is the one that’s been training with Frieza for these past four months, so it’s understandable that Frieza’s sparring partner would gain a hefty boost of strength in the process.

Tagoma seems to run around with a personality not unlike the first glimpses that we saw of Vegeta. He’s brash, power-hungry, and infinitely determined khổng lồ be the best. It’s an attitude that might be an asset khổng lồ Frieza’s army, but one that’s also going to lớn make quite the opponent for these guys in the next episode.
